quinta-feira, 23 de abril de 2009

Meu roteiro de instalacao do Ubuntu 9.04

Este artigo descreve o meu roteiro de atualização dos meus computadores pessoais com o Ubuntu. Eu costumo instalar muitos programas, seja para testar ou mesmo para usar nas aulas que ministro. Assim, a cada seis meses, quando sai uma versão nova do Ubuntu, costumo fazer uma reinstalação completa desses computadores. Eu também costumo adaptar esses computadores ao meu gosto, e sempre que os reinstalo, preciso sair à procura das modificações que havia feito.

Sendo assim, resolvi anotar cuidadosamente cada modificação feita na instalação do Ubuntu 9.04, conhecido como Jaunty Jackalope. Estes roteiro fo criado pensando nas minhas necessidades, porém acredito que muitas das configurações aqui descritas podem ser úteis para outras pessoas. Percebi também que muitas configurações que eu fazia, vieram por padrão nesta versão do Ubuntu.

Se você tem dúvidas, correções a fazer ou outras configurações a sugerir, envie um comentário. Terei prazer em ler e responder.

Configurações do firefox:
- Tirar barra de favoritos
- Mudar ícones para pequenos
- Colocar ícone de "Nova aba"
- Colocar página inicial: http://google.com/ig
- Adicionar Pesquisas: http://mycroft.mozdev.org/
-- MercadoLivre, Youtube, Torrenttab







Configurações do ambiente de trabalho:

- Colocar ícones na barra superior: terminal e gedit
- Retirar ícones: help e evolution
- Colocar lista de abas na barra superior
- Retirar barra inferior
- Mudar tema e papel de parede
- Habilitar efeitos








- Baixar e instalar o Ubuntu perfeito

Instalar extensões do Firefox:
- Adblock Plus
- Better GReader
- Colt
- Delicious
- Download Helper
- Forecastfox l10n
- Google Preview

- noScript
- Twitterfox

- Ubuntu Firefox Modifications
Screenlets
- Relogio, Calendário, Temperatura do processador

Fonte Monaco
- Instalar a fonte:
cd /usr/share/fonts/truetype
sudo mkdir myfonts
cd myfonts
sudo cp /dados/downloads/Monaco_Linux.ttf .
sudo chown root.root *.ttf
sudo mkfontdir
cd ..
fc-cache

Configurações de Terminal:
- Histórico do bash: adicionar:
export HISTSIZE=5000
- Alias: descomentar linhas de .bashrc

- .inputrc:


set completion-ignore-case On
"\e[B": history-search-forward
"\e[A": history-search-backward


Vi
set completion-ignore-case On
"\e[B": history-search-forward
"\e[A": history-search-backward

sudo aptitude install vim-full

Latex:
sudo aptitude install texlive texlive-humanities latex-beamer abntex aspell-pt-br \
gedit-plugins rubber texmaker

Webcam:
sudo aptitude install cheese

Man colorido
- instalar most
- sudo update-alternatives --config pager

Configurar Skype
- A definir: como fazer o mic interno funcionar

Python:
sudo aptitude install ipython
- baixar e instalar o wind-ide-101

Gedit:
- ativar plugins e modificar configurações (pendente)
- Utilizar fonte Monaco
- instalar plugins: latex open_terminal better_python_console
- gedit-latex-plugin_0.1.3.1-2~0ubuntuitdev1_i386.deb

Gnome-do:
sudo aptitude install gnome-do gnome-do-plugins

Nautilus:
sudo aptitude install nautilus-open-terminal
- baixar e instalar
-- nautilus-send-gmail_0.1.1-1_all.deb
-- nautilus-rename-exif-date_0.1.1-1_all.deb - trocar linhas:
-- Alterar o programa /usr/lib/nautilus/extensions-2.0/python/nautilus-rename-exif-date.py
def menu_activate_cb(self, menu, names):
"""Called when the user selects the menu. Rename the selected files."""
for path in names:
img_file = open(path, "rb")
tags = EXIF.process_file(img_file)
date = str(tags["EXIF DateTimeOriginal"]).replace(":", "-", 2)
date = date.replace(":", "", 1)
date = date.replace(":", "", 1)
date = date.replace(":", "",1)
date = date.replace(" ", "-",1)

dir_name = os.path.split(path)[0]
file_name = os.path.split(path)[1]
parts = file_name.split(".")
if len(parts) == 1:
extension = ""
else:
extension = "." + parts[-1].lower()
os.rename(path, dir_name + "/" + date + extension)
Adicionar scripts a ~/.gnome2/nautilus-scripts (menu de contexto)

Picasa:
# Google
Adicionar ao /etc/sources.list:
deb http://dl.google.com/linux/deb/ stable non-free deb http://dl.google.com/linux/deb/ testing non-free sudo aptitude install picasa
Links simbólicos para pastas: ln -s destino
aulas -> /dados/MARCOANDRE/aulas/
documentos -> /dados/documentos/
imagens -> /dados/imagens/
musicas -> /dados/musicas/
videos -> /dados/videos/

Ativar o CTRL+ALT+BACKSPACE:
sudo vi /etc/X11/xorg.conf
Section "ServerFlags"
Option "DontZap" "false" EndSection

Impressora Brother do IST:
sudo aptitude install brother-cups-wrapper-laser

DVD:
sudo aptitude install dvdrip devede

Jpilot:
sudo aptitude install jpilot jpilot-plugins jpilot-backup jppy-jpilot-plugins

Diff:
sudo aptitude install meld

Gcompris:
sudo aptitude install gcompris-sound-ptbr

IRC:
sudo aptitude install xchat
- Modificar encoding para utf-8
- Usar fonte Monaco

Desinstalar:
-sudo aptitude remove evolution ekiga

Instalar:
- amule
- gparted
- powertop

Quebra-cabeça:
- instalar xij:
sudo aptitude install xjig -criar script quebra_cabeca:
#!/bin/bash eog $1 & xjig -side p -h 6 -ww 320 -file $1 &
- colocar na pasta de scripts do Nautilus
cp /usr/local/bin/puzzle /home/marco/.gnome2/nautilus-scripts/

13 comentários:

Anônimo disse...

Há cerca de uns 13 anos amo Linux e já fui a Feiras e Reuniões, e dia de Linux em Colatina,ES. Mas continuo um novato e ainda não tive coragem de instalar um Linux no meu PC.
Gostaria de contar com um guru que me ajudasse nesta tarefa, pois não entendo nada de programação e de instalação.
Resido próximo ao Shopping Iguatemi.
Precisaria de alguém que tenha paciência pois sou limitado na compreensão de algo que tenho contato pela primeira vez.
Agradeço a atenção e a boa vontade de alguém que se voluntaria e me possa ajudar nesta tarefa. Amém!
Meu Telefone é (51)9671-1950.
Muito Obrigado e Agradecido.
Amém!

Unknown disse...

show de bola marco a idéia de fazer um roteiro. A cada instalação sempre esqueço de algo .. hehe .. mas como faço mtas coisas desse seu roteiro, vou apenas adaptá-lo a minha realidade =).

Valeu pela dica.

Anônimo disse...

excelente post!
1abraço

Valdinei dos Santos disse...

Gostei do roteiro me foi muito util

coyoterj disse...

Show Marco, como eu gostaria de ser organizado assim. Sério.
Mas depois de seu exemplo vou tentar, porque é dose a cada atualização ter que customizar tudo...

Abs

MARCO ANDRE LOPES MENDES disse...

Obrigado. Faça o seu roteiro e compartilhe.

Eu vinha pensando em fazer isso há tempo. Inicialmente pensei em fazer um script, mas acredito que assim eu posso ir escolhendo o que fazer. Fui criando o roteiro na instalação do Ubuntu 9.04. A cada modificação, anotava o que tinha feito. O próximo passo é comentar cada opção.

Marco Aurélio disse...

Boa ideia esse roteiro eim..

acho q vou começar com algo não tão detalhado, compactivel com meu nível de disciplina =P

Fred disse...

Dúvida de leigo (conheço o ubuntu há pouco tempo...):
Se mando atualizar a versão ele não mantém todos os programas já instalados com as configurações aplicadas?

MARCO ANDRE LOPES MENDES disse...

Fred: este deveria ser o comportamento normal. Eu fiz a atualização do meu desktop em casa, e utilizamos duas contas nele. Em ambas, não notei nenhum programa que não tenha mantida as configurações. Aconteceu algum problema com você?

Fred disse...

Na verdade, não. A pergunta foi por confundir no título "instalação" com "atualização".
Mas aí surge outra dúvida: com que frequência é necessário uma nova instalação? Com o windows XP eu fazia a cada ano ou ano e meio. Agora com o Vista ainda não precisei (mais estou há menos de um ano)
Uso o Ubuntu desde a versão 7.10, eu acho. Mas não sou parâmetro, pois uso muito raramente.
Agora estou começando a customizar melhor os aplicativos no notebook pra ver se começo a usar com mais frequência. Pretendo começar a abandonar o Windows no trabalho. Tenho essa facilidade pq o órgão público em que trabalho nos dá a opção de sistema operacional.

Anônimo disse...

Legal, parabéns pelo detalhamento que eu jamais teria paciência. Bem que podiam bolar um script pra fazer tudo isso sozinho né!!

abraço

Unknown disse...

Gostei muito sou usuari de linux a 2 meses ainda nao consegui fazer o skype funcionar mas meu desktop ta muito xou com alguns do seu roteiros

Anônimo disse...

Realmente uma coisa tão simples como um roteiro e acabamos esquecendo de deixar registrado e que no final acaba poupando muito tempo.
Parabéns.